Transaction e32ade19187243f3b136dfc88ed32d98d7b3b43af33d9a8646a78c8d9d3644af

1 Input
2 Outputs
  • e32ade19187243f3b136dfc88ed32d98d7b3b43af33d9a8646a78c8d9d3644af:0
  • value  75000000
    address  385hSD41yasxrHriapRW5qFgWAUieiezHs
  • e32ade19187243f3b136dfc88ed32d98d7b3b43af33d9a8646a78c8d9d3644af:1
  • value  693950688
    address  3LUZTFhceMktUw9kFuTuST9ox45BzgzU8D